Top definition
When a ginger intrudes on your game. Whether it be playing beer pong, or attempting to get laid, the soul-less presence of a ginger casts a spell, similar to witchcraft, preventing you from your planned happiness.
Damn, I was doing great at beer pong till Kelly used her gingercraft and killed my game.
by SeeQuick January 31, 2011
Get the mug
Get a Gingercraft mug for your cousin Manley.